Mid North Christian College is a co-educational, Christian, Boutique school from Prep to Year 12 in Port Pirie, South Australia. It sits in the Highly Capable tier on Schools360. Its strongest area is Student Wellbeing, where it reaches Leading tier. It ranks 12th among private regional schools in South Australia.

ICSEA measures the socio-educational background of a school’s student population — the occupation and education of families, the school’s geographic location, and the proportion of Indigenous students it enrols. It is not a measure of school quality or performance. The national average is 1000.
